What is the Madhucon Founding Story?

The story of the Madhucon Company, now known as Madhucon Infra Limited, began in 1990, though its roots stretch back further. The company's journey started with a focus on addressing the critical need for infrastructure development in India, aiming to build essential projects across the country.

The initial steps involved taking over the existing construction business of M/s Madho Constructions, a partnership concern. This transition marked the beginning of Madhucon Projects Limited, setting the stage for its expansion and impact on the Indian construction landscape.

The company was founded on March 15, 1990, as Madhu Continental Constructions Private Limited. The founders, Shri N. Seethaiah and Shri N. Krishnaiah, played a key role. Shri N. Nageswara Rao later joined as Managing Director.

What Drove the Early Growth of Madhucon?

The early growth of the Madhucon Company, an infrastructure company, was marked by a significant expansion of its project portfolio and strategic diversification into various infrastructure sectors. After becoming a public limited company in 1995, the company showed its intent for substantial growth. This expansion included road construction projects, bridge construction, and power projects, demonstrating its commitment to becoming a major player in the Indian construction industry.

Icon Early Strategic Moves

In 1995, Madhucon entered into a Memorandum of Understanding with Bina Puri Holdings BHD, Malaysia, for highway execution. The company executed three flyovers in Hyderabad in 1997. Securing a contract from the National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) for strengthening NH-5 from Vijayawada to Eluru, completed in 1999, was another key project.

Icon Early Project Successes

The Hymavathi Hydel Dam project in Karnataka was successfully completed in 1998. These early projects set the stage for the company's future growth. These projects highlight the company's early capabilities in both road and infrastructure development, which are key aspects of the Madhucon history.

Icon Growth in the Early 2000s

The early 2000s saw substantial growth for Madhucon. The company was awarded National Highway Projects worth ₹3,200 million in Andhra Pradesh and Rajasthan in 2000. This was followed by an additional ₹3,100 million in projects in Andhra Pradesh and Tamil Nadu in 2001. These projects significantly boosted the company's portfolio.

Icon Awards and Recognition

The company's growth was recognized with the 'Fastest Growing Construction Company - 2nd Rank Award' in 2003 and the '1st Rank Award' in 2004 from Construction World National Institute of Construction Management and Research (NICMAR). Despite its successes, Madhucon has faced considerable challenges, particularly in recent years, affecting its financial stability and operational performance. These issues reflect broader economic pressures within the infrastructure sector.

Icon

Financial Difficulties

Madhucon reported a consolidated net loss of ₹38.87 crore in the quarter ended March 2025 and a net loss of ₹475.21 crore for the full year ended March 2025. Sales declined by 41.86% to ₹676.56 crore in the year ended March 2025.

Icon

Loan Defaults

The company faced issues with loan defaults, including an interim order from NCLT, Hyderabad, in January 2025, related to outstanding loan and interest amounts filed by Canara Bank. As of March 31, 2025, Madhucon Projects Limited reported defaults on a loan of INR 67.86 crore.

Icon

Credit Rating Downgrade

ICRA placed the company's credit ratings in the 'Issuer Not Cooperating' category due to a lack of information and non-payment of surveillance fees as of September 2024. This downgrade reflects concerns about the company's financial health and operational transparency.

What is the Timeline of Key Events for Madhucon?

The Madhucon Company, an infrastructure company, has a rich history marked by significant achievements and strategic shifts. The company's journey began in 1990 and has since evolved, encompassing various infrastructure projects across India. This timeline highlights key milestones in the company's development, showcasing its expansion and diversification within the construction and infrastructure sectors.

Year Key Event
1990 Incorporated as Madhu Continental Constructions Private Limited, marking the beginning of its journey in the construction industry.
1994 Received the 'Quality Construction Award' from Konkan Railway Corporation Ltd, recognizing early success.
1995 Converted to a public limited company and renamed Madhucon Projects Limited, signaling growth and expansion.
1997 Executed three flyovers in Hyderabad and secured a NHAI contract for NH-5, expanding its road construction portfolio.
1998 Completed the Hymavathi Hydel Dam project in Karnataka, demonstrating its capabilities in diverse infrastructure projects.
2000 Awarded National Highway Projects worth ₹3,200 million in Andhra Pradesh and Rajasthan, boosting its financial standing.
2003 Recognized as the 'Fastest Growing Construction Company - 2nd Rank', reflecting its rapid expansion.
2004 Awarded 'Fastest Growing Construction Company - 1st Rank', highlighting its industry leadership.
2005 Honored with the 'Innovation in Road Construction Award', showcasing its commitment to innovation.
2006 Floated a Global Depositary Receipts (GDR) issue, indicating its access to global financial markets.
2007 Entered the power sector with 48% equity in Simhapuri Energy Private and secured significant irrigation and road projects, diversifying its business.
2008 Bagged an EPC contract of ₹9.89 billion for a thermal power plant, expanding into the power sector.
2009 Madhucon Agra - Jaipur Expressways Limited became commercially operational, demonstrating its capabilities in expressway projects.
2014 Phase I (2x150 MW) of Simhapuri Energy Limited completed, showcasing its power project execution.
2025 (March) Reported a consolidated net loss of ₹38.87 crore for the quarter and ₹475.21 crore for the full year, reflecting recent financial challenges.
2025 (January) Received an interim order from NCLT due to loan defaults, indicating financial strain.
